The ArmMotus EMU is a rehabilitation robot for the upper extremities that enables movement in three dimensions of space. The patient is only connected to the device at a single point along the forearm, so he or she can move in a wide variety of ways: sitting or standing, with a free hand or with a handle. Furthermore, training actions can be carried out in a virtual (game) environment or with real objects. The robot simulates the touch of a therapist by exerting various forces on the patient. The cable-driven mechanism with a parallel linkage made of carbon fibre reduces the friction and inertia of the robot’s movements.
